This Woman Was Stopped By Police Officer Because They Thought She Was Walking Naked



A woman was stopped by police who thought she was wandering around the streets half-naked in the middle of the day.

Abbie Crawford was walking in a tiny pair of hot pants that were obscured by her coat. The 25-year-old, who went viral after confused locals in Newton-Le-Willows in Merseyside took photos of her after mistaking her for being naked.

Borno Cancels Holiday To Mark Sambisa's Fall

Borno State Government has shelved its plan to declare Friday (today) as a public holiday to mark the capture of Sambisa Forest from the Boko Haram insurgents.

The state Commissioner for Home Affairs, Information and Culture, Mohammed Bulama, in a statement issued on Thursday in Maiduguri explained that the holiday was cancelled “on the grounds that since 22ndDecember of this year falls on a Friday which coincidentally dovetails into a four-day work-free period occasioned by the Christmas festivities.

A declaration of the day as a public holiday will invariably deny Nigerian workers resident in Borno State, especially those who will observe and celebrate Christmas, the opportunity to withdraw their December salaries from the banks”.

Lawyer Urges Senate To Swear In Osinbanjoi As Acting President of Federal Republic of Nigeria

 
A Lagos-based lawyer, Ebun-Olu Adegboruwa, has urged the Nigerian Senate to declare the office of the president vacant and constitute a medical panel of experts to examine the health status of Muhammadu Buhari in order to determine if he can still continue to function in office.

In a statement on Tuesday, Mr. Adegboruwa said the Constitution anticipates a fit and proper chief executive, to run the affairs of Nigeria.
